abstract = "Cardiothoracic surgeons provide care to neonates, children, adults, and the elderly with a range of disorders of the heart, lungs, esophagus, and major blood vessels of the chest. The field of cardiothoracic surgery continues to thrive among the transformations in thoracic and cardiovascular medicine. This article is intended to provide a guide to medical students and physicians on the training, certification, research, and funding opportunities as well as societies and journals specific to cardiothoracic surgery.",

note = "Funding Information: The Thoracic Surgery Foundation for Research and Education (TSFRE) is dedicated to increasing the knowledge base of cardiothoracic surgery and to enhancing the knowledge of all thoracic surgeons. The Foundation is supported by the 4 major thoracic surgery professional societies: the AATS, the Society of Thoracic Surgeons (STS), the Southern Thoracic Surgical Association (STSA), and the Western Thoracic Surgical Association (WTSA). The TSFRE provides fellowships and research grants to surgeons and surgical trainees in the field of cardiothoracic surgery. Funding Information: Research funding is available through the National Institutions of Health (NIH), the National Cancer Institute, or the National Heart, Lung, Blood Institute as either participants in already established projects or through a supplemental project to a major grant. Funded projects through the NIH are listed on the NIH web site. The TSFRE has been generous in matching many K08 and K23 awards through the National Heart, Lung, Blood Institute or the National Cancer Institute to aid in providing protected time to young academic cardiothoracic surgeons.
